Medieval Bridge of Frías · Frías

POI

One of the most valuable monuments of the city of Frias is its bridge over the Ebro. It can be said that its origin was of Roman construction and rebuilt several times in the Middle Ages. It passes through it, the Roman road, which was a means of communication, very important for trade between the Plateau and the Cantabrian coast. It came through the Portillo de Busto, Tobera, Frías, passes through the Herrán gorge and reached Orduña, from where the merchants went to Bilbao.
